THOMAS
THOMAS is a Texas oil lease in Upton County, Railroad Commission district 7C, operated by Cox, John L. It has 1 wellbore on file with the Commission. Reported production runs from January 1993 to August 1998, totalling 8,706 barrels. The lease is not currently producing. Its strongest month on the record we hold was March 1993, at 273 barrels.
